I have an 05 Liberty and my front end was making a crunching noise when I hit bumps that really compressed my front end. So I took it to a shop where they told me I needed shocks, struts, and tires. So I figured why the hell not, so I bought rusty's a suspension lift kit that included the socks and struts. My car still makes the same crunching when I hit large bumps. Any ideas??

I believe several people have that (I am one) and it's been identified as the control-arm bushings.

The jury is still out if it's a problem, or if you should lubricate them. Some people say you should, some people say it will damage them. I haven't touched mine, and I live with the noise. And the noise only occurs when the temperature drops below about 50 degrees. Once the weather warms up, the noise goes away.
